What is a Food Truck Festival?

An occasion where several food trucks congregate in one place is a food truck festival. Each visitor may now discover the best cuisine available in their city or region. To attract attendees, many festivals also include live music or other entertaining activities.

The Benefits of Selling at Food Truck Festivals

Almost anywhere may be used to set up a food truck. To consider this kind of event, consider the following:

  • Reach new customers: Food truck fare instantly piques the curiosity of festival goers. Your company might not be noticed by many people in your usual areas. However, when they congregate in one place, you can attract additional curious eaters.
  • Target specific audiences: For food trucks, figuring out the local clientele might be challenging. Special events, on the other hand, frequently use more precise marketing and may even keep track of previous attendees. so that you may precisely target your target market.
  • Increase brand visibility: Even if some customers decide not to eat your food, at least they will pass by your truck and take note of your branding and menu. Some people might decide to follow you on social media or remember to come back later.
  • Enjoy an easy sign-up process: Vendor regulations and fees are common at festivals. However, they typically make it simple to sign up and guarantee compliance. To determine whether you can set up in a particular place, you shouldn’t need to look for licenses or put in a lot of effort.

How to Attend a Food Truck Festival

Here are some steps to get started if you want to take advantage of culinary festivals:

  1. Do some research on local events.
  2. Contact the event’s organizers or apply online.
  3. assemble the necessary paperwork, such as business insurance and licenses. For your particular event, look out for further requirements.
  4. On social networking and food truck locator applications, update your location.

The Legalities

Generally speaking, food enterprises require a license from their local health authority. You might also require a vending license from the municipality where the festival is held. Food Truck Festival Sales Tips

These suggestions will help you increase sales if you want to have one of the greatest food trucks at the events you go to.

Create Special Menu Items

Include surprising ingredient combinations to attract attendance since food truck patrons enjoy experimenting with new combinations. Consider offering them modest samples as well, as they will probably be eating different foods throughout the event.

Update Your Location Online

By updating your social media profiles and meal-finding apps, you can attract more devoted clients. The marketing materials at the event should also include your handles so that people may follow you later.

Simplify Transactions

Make your menu plainly visible and provide a variety of payment methods because attendees want to grab their food quickly and keep moving. Keep your line moving by streamlining the process with mobile ordering and payments.

Create Memorable Branding and Signs

Bright colors, sharp contrasts, and attractive slogans will attract clients. Right outside your truck, put up a sizable sign with your menu. You might also think about placing signs elsewhere at the event.

Partner with Other Food Trucks

Make it simple for event attendees to experience several types of cuisine since many of them try meals from several vendors. For instance, design a “food tour” with trucks positioned in various locations to propose unusual foods to try.

Festivals: how do food trucks get in?

Although the procedure varies from festival to festival, most let vendors apply online. Permission or license from the local health authority is probably required, along with payment of a vendor charge.

How much do they make?

The size of the event and your menu pricing will determine how much money you can make at a food festival. However, at modestly sized events, food trucks frequently make $1,000 or more.
